Tennessee Citizen Voting-age Population By County in 2015 (ACS-5Yrs)

Updated on March 28, 2026.

Based on the US Census Bureau's special tabulation from the ACS 5-year estimates, in 2015, the citizen voting-age population for Tennessee was 4,828,365 and represented 74.29% of the total Tennessee population.

Among all Tennessee counties, Shelby had the highest citizen voting-age population (662.72K), followed by Davidson (469.67K), and Knox (337.59K).

In terms of percentages, Lake had the highest percentage of its population being citizens of voting-age (82.43%), followed by Johnson (81.32%), and Pickett (81.26%).
